Where have all the queer kids gone? How Queers Got Abandoned by Film Then Got Adopted by The Cooler Sibling, TV

Olivo, Juliana Christina

Abstract Details

2021, Bachelor of Fine Arts (BFA), Ohio University, Film.
Juliana Olivo's paper, "Where have all the queer kids gone?" examines why and how queer and trans representation seem to be blooming in American television. It provides historical context and analyzes 3 popular American TV shows with breakthrough trans and queer characters.
